Coach Road 'Peckers

There was a grand total of 6 G S 'Peckers at Coach Road today, along with the usual woodland species, including 3 Song Thrushes, Chiffchaffs and Nuthatches. It seems more than likely that the increasing number of Great Spots have helped to drive out the Lesser Spots from their traditional site, as there have been no sightings for over a year now.
